Petriv Takes Out Antoniou

Level 19 : Blinds 5,000/10,000, 10,000 ante
Andreas Antoniou
Andreas Antoniou

Stanislav Petriv raised to 20,000 under the gun and Andreas Antoniou moved all in for 88,000 in middle position. Andreas Goeller called in the small blind, while Petriv also called.

The flop came Q73 and Goeller quickly check-folded to a bet of 60,000 from Petriv.

Andreas Antoniou: 55 All in
Stanislav Petriv: 1010

Antoniou was trailing against Petriv's tens and the rest of the board came 4A to seal his elimination.

Davenport Flops the Nuts to Bust Lyubovetskiy

Level 18 : Blinds 4,000/8,000, 8,000 ante
Matthew Davenport
Matthew Davenport

Matthew Davenport and Andriy Lyubovetskiy both checked the turn on a board of 10QQ8 and Lyubovetskiy also checked the 6 river.

Davenport then moved all in from under the gun and Lyubovetskiy, with around 60,000 remaining, used a few time banks before calling in the big blind.

Davenport showed Q10 for the flopped full house and Lyubovetskiy threw 108 into the muck on his way to collect his payout.

Nicolas Oger and Laurent Cessy were also recently eliminated.

Malec Claims Another Bustout as Cibicek Falls

Level 18 : Blinds 4,000/8,000, 8,000 ante
Jozef Cibicek
Jozef Cibicek

Jozef Cibicek was all in with a relatively short stack of 230,000 and was looked up by Sebastian Malec, who had him well covered as players flipped their cards.

Jozef Cibicek: QQ All in
Sebastian Malec: AK

The board ran out 710A46 and Malec paired his ace on the flop to win the pot, sending Cibicek to the exit. After eliminating Nemeth moments before, Malec had busted another player from his table and added yet more to his stack.

Baraza Runs Into Navas' Kings in Massive Pot

Level 18 : Blinds 4,000/8,000, 8,000 ante
Juan Baraza
Juan Baraza

Around 200,000 was already in the middle as Juan Baraza and Rafael Navas went to the turn on a board of 8496. Baraza then got his last 200,000 in from under the gun while Navas put him at risk in middle position.

Baraza showed QQ, but Navas turned over KK as the 4 river sent the massive pot to Navas while Baraza hit the rail.

Nemeth Picks Wrong Moment to Bluff-Catch

Level 18 : Blinds 4,000/8,000, 8,000 ante
Andras Nemeth
Andras Nemeth

Action was on the turn on a board of 6223 with around 170,000 in the middle. Sebastian Malec made it 100,000 to go and Andras Nemeth made the call.

The river came the 2 and Malec announced that he was "all in" with the covering stack. Nemeth went deep into the tank, using three time bank cards to make his decision before opting to call.

Malec showed QQ for a full house, deuces full of queens. Nemeth was left stunned and the dealer prompted him to turn over his cards.

Nemeth showed A10. He'd missed his flush draw and was using his hand as a bluff-catcher. Unfortunately for Nemeth, Malec was far from bluffing. Malec scooped in the pot and Nemeth was eliminated.

Toledano Building Massive Stack, Busts Prusov

Level 18 : Blinds 4,000/8,000, 8,000 ante
Valeriano Toledano
Valeriano Toledano

Valeriano Toledano raised to 16,000 under the gun and Nacho Barbero called on the button. Dmitrii Prusov then moved all in for 130,000 in the small blind and Toledano called, while Barbero took a moment before folding.

Dmitrii Prusov: A9 All in
Valeriano Toledano: 1010

"Ace-jack, I had," Barbero said as Toledano and Prusov saw the Q9Q flop, which gave both players two pair. The rest of the board came 26 and Toledano's tens stayed in the lead to send Prusov to the rail as he boosted his stack past 1,000,000.

Aces Versus Kings Everywhere

Level 18 : Blinds 4,000/8,000, 8,000 ante
Ka Kwan Lau
Ka Kwan Lau

Ka Kwan Lau three-bet to 55,000 on the button, Ivo Bartoletti moved all in from early position, and Lau called for 200,000.

Ka Kwan Lau: KK All in
Ivo Bartoletti: AA

Lau had run his kings into Bartoletti's aces and found no miracles on the 109410Q board as he fell victim to the massive cooler.

At the same time at another table, Milos Petakovic was all in for 85,000 from under the gun and up against Kestutis Jungevicius in the hijack.

Milos Petakovic: KK All in
Kestutis Jungevicius: AA

It was another aces versus kings cooler, and Petakovic shared Lau's fate as the board came 91035A to give Jungevicius a set and the bustout.

Margets Runs Into Cristiani's Kings

Level 18 : Blinds 4,000/8,000, 8,000 ante
Leo Margets
Leo Margets

Leo Margets raised to 16,000 in the hijack, Jean Cristiani moved all in from the small blind, and Margets called for her last 150,000.

Leo Margets: AK All in
Jean Cristiani: KK

Margets was left looking for an ace to crack Cristiani's kings and keep her tournament hopes alive, but no help arrived on the 58Q77 board and she was eliminated.

Mehdi Rebai was also recently eliminated.
